Dr. Robert Semba is a general orthopedic surgeon who treats a wide variety of musculoskeletal issues, ranging from simple fractures to congenital disorders to wear-and-tear problems typically found later in life.
His practice focuses on both nonoperative solutions like physical therapy and steroid injections, as well as arthroscopic surgery, trauma surgery, and joint reconstruction and replacement.
Dr. Semba grew up in Minneapolis. Raised in a family of physicians, he says he was destined for the medical field. He moved to the west coast to attend Stanford University for his undergraduate studies, then returned to the Midwest to pursue his M.D. at the University of Minnesota Medical School. In 1987, he completed his residency in the Department of Orthopaedic Surgery at the University of Minnesota.
